Yes, many sport bikes use "spools." The T-Rex can lift the motorcycle either by the swingarm or by spools! To choose either method you merely rotate the gold-colored lifting arms. Since my dual sport motorcycle does not have spools, I am lifting my bike by the swingarm itself.
